Discovering Clone Negatives via Adaptive Contrastive Learning for Image-Text Matching

ICLR 2025poster

In this paper, we identify a common yet challenging issue in image-text matching, i.e., clone negatives: negative image-text pairs that semantically resemble positive pairs, leading to ambiguous and sub-optimal matching outcomes. To tackle this issue, we propose Adaptive Contrastive Learning (AdaCL)…
